#7e0d99 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#7e0d99 is composed of 49.4% red, 5.1% green and 60%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 17.6% cyan, 91.5% magenta, 0% yellow and 40% black. It has a hue angle of 288.4 degrees, a saturation of 84.3% and a lightness of 32.5%. #7e0d99 color hex could be obtained by blending #fc1aff with #000033. Closest websafe color is: #660099.

Shades and Tints of #7e0d99

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#070108 is the darkest color, while #fcf5fe is the lightest one.

Tones of #7e0d99

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#574d59 is the less saturated color, while #8600a6 is the most saturated one.
